Understanding the Editing Process
Before diving into specific techniques, it is crucial to comprehend the editing process as a whole. Familiarize yourself with the various stages of editing, including substantive editing, copy editing, and proofreading. Each stage serves a unique purpose, focusing on different aspects of the manuscript. By understanding the process, editors can approach their work more strategically and ensure that they address the manuscript’s needs comprehensively.
Developing a Systematic Approach
An effective book editor develops a systematic approach to editing. Establish a clear workflow that includes thorough reading, note-taking, and the use of appropriate tools. Start by reading the manuscript in its entirety to grasp its structure, plot, and characters. Take meticulous notes on areas that require improvement, such as plot inconsistencies, character development, or pacing issues. Utilize digital tools, style guides, and grammar references to enhance your editing process.
Strengthening Structure and Organization
One of the essential aspects of book editing is refining the structure and organization of the manuscript. Assess the overall flow of the narrative, ensuring that the plot progresses logically and coherently. Look for gaps in the story or areas that require further development. Analyze the pacing, ensuring it aligns with the genre and keeps readers engaged. Make use of outlines, storyboards, or other visual aids to visualize the structure and identify areas that may need revision.
Enhancing Language and Style
Language and style are key components of a well-edited book. Pay attention to the author’s voice and writing style, ensuring consistency throughout the manuscript. Eliminate redundancies, clichés, and awkward phrasing. Strive for clarity and conciseness, removing any unnecessary or confusing passages. Enhance the dialogue, making it authentic and engaging. Be mindful of the target audience and adjust the language accordingly, avoiding jargon or excessive technical terms when not required.
Polishing Grammar and Mechanics
While editing for grammar and mechanics may seem like a straightforward task, it is essential to approach it with precision and attention to detail. Brush up on grammar rules and common punctuation guidelines. Check for spelling errors, typos, and grammatical inconsistencies. Ensure consistency in the use of tense, point of view, and verb agreement. Maintain a style sheet to document any specific preferences or rules specific to the manuscript.
Collaborating with Authors
Effective collaboration with authors is crucial for successful book editing. Establish open lines of communication, fostering a constructive relationship based on trust and mutual respect. Clearly communicate your suggestions and edits, providing explanations for any major changes. Seek the author’s input and incorporate their feedback where appropriate. Remember that the ultimate goal is to enhance the manuscript while honoring the author’s vision.
